Moti Tola - Bagaha, Pashchim Champaran

Moti Tola is a village situated in the Bagaha subdivision of Pashchim Champaran district, Bihar. It is located approximately 3 km from the tehsil headquarters in Bagaha and around 37 km from the district headquarters in Bettiah. Inglisiya serves as the Gram Panchayat for Moti Tola village.

As per Census 2011, the village code of Moti Tola is 216954. The village covers a total geographical area of 81.3 hectares and falls under the 845101 pincode. Bagha is the nearest town, located about 24 km away.

Moti Tola village is governed under the Panchayati Raj system, with a Sarpanch serving as the elected head.

Population of Moti Tola

As per Census 2011, Moti Tola village has a total population of 930 people, consisting of 500 males and 430 females. The village has 175 households and a sex ratio of 860 females per 1,000 males. There are 187 children in the 0–6 years age group. The village has 357 literate and 573 illiterate residents. Additionally, 10 people belong to Scheduled Tribe (ST) communities.

Transport and Connectivity of Moti Tola

Public transport in the Moti Tola is mainly available through shared auto-rickshaws. The nearest railway station is Musharwa Halt, while the nearest airport is Raxaul Airport, situated at an approximate aerial distance of 42.7 km.

The road distance from Bagha to Moti Tola is about 24 km, with a usual travel time of around 30-60 minutes. Similarly, the road distance from Bettiah to Moti Tola is about 37 km, with the usual travel time around 1-1.25 hours. Actual travel time may vary depending on road conditions and mode of transport.
